This was an interesting taste. The purple is explained on their site as a similar to the pigment in red cabbage. Very interesting in it's properties, but I guess I thought the tea would be purple and it wasn't. Brewed up similar to a mild black tea.

I'm still not sure where purple tea fits in the spectrum of tea but I thought I would try. First off, absolutely no bitterness and this tea is light and even slightly sweet. There is also a woody flavor. Still not sure where it fits, but it is not a black tea and more than a white or green tea. (195F for 4min)
